Description
1,1-Dibromo-1-Nitroethane is a specialized halogenated nitroalkane building block of significant interest in advanced organic synthesis. Its unique structure, featuring both bromine and nitro functional groups, makes it a versatile reagent for constructing complex molecular frameworks. This compound is primarily utilized by research chemists and process development scientists in the pharmaceutical and agrochemical industries for the synthesis of novel active ingredients and fine chemicals.

Basic Information
| Product Name | 1,1-Dibromo-1-Nitroethane |
| CAS No. | 7119-88-2 |
| Molecular Formula | C2H3Br2NO2 |
| Molecular Weight | 232.86 g/mol |
| Synonyms | 1,1-Dibromo-1-nitroethane; Dibromonitroethane; Nitrodibromoethane; Ethane, 1,1-dibromo-1-nitro-; NSC 60545; α,α-Dibromo-α-nitroethane; 1-Nitro-1,1-dibromoethane |

Storage
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area away from incompatible materials such as strong acids and organic solvents. Recommended storage temperature is 2-8°C for extended stability. Keep container tightly sealed when not in use to prevent moisture ingress and degradation.
